How a Preview Image Increased a Landing Page’s Conversion Rate by 359%

How a Preview Image Increased a Landing Page’s Conversion Rate by 359% – Search Engine Watch (#SEW)

http://searchenginewatch.com/article/2220391/How-a-Preview-Image-Increased-a-Landing-Pages-Conversion-Rate-by-359

The results of the test were conclusive – a landing page that includes a preview image of the offer had a 359 percent higher conversion rate than a landing page without the preview image

Video With Mountain Lion Dictation tricks

If you’ve got Mountain Lion this video will help you get the most out Apples Dictation.

http://www.macworld.com/article/1168477/mountain_lion_dictation_tricks.html

Mountain Lion includes a feature Apple calls Dictation, which lets you talk to your Mac and have your text transcribed by the OS, anywhere you can type. We have another video that walks you through getting Dictation set up. Now that you’re ready to dictate, let’s go through a few clever dictation tricks you should learn to make the service more useful.

The Future is SoLoMoCo: 5 Predictions for Digital Marketing

I’m a real believer in SoLoMo and currently building an app around it. However, this article has inspired me to write an article with my own views and tips for you but until then… Read on.

The Future is SoLoMoCo: 5 Predictions for Digital Marketing…

http://socialmediatoday.com/sbohan/562244/future-solomoco-5-predictions-digital-marketing

Is the future of digital marketing “solomoco”?

At the recent Vocus user conference, I attended a session about the future of digital marketing. The speaker, Tim Reis, Head of Social and Mobile Solutions for Google – Americas sums up the next few years for marketers and businesses in general as “solomoco”: social, local, mobile, commerce. Marketers have been hearing a whole lot about mobile and social lately as these channels are growing in significance and influence.
